About Sadipur

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Sadipur village is 255042. Sadipur village is located in Khizirsarai subdivision of Gaya district in Bihar,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Khizirsarai (tehsildar office) and 16km away from district headquarter Gaya. As per 2009 stats, Kutlupur is the gram panchayat of Sadipur village.

The total geographical area of village is 88 hectares. Sadipur has a total population of 980 peoples, out of which male population is 475 while female population is 505. Literacy rate of sadipur village is 56.63% out of which 65.68% males and 48.12% females are literate. There are about 211 houses in sadipur village. Pincode of sadipur village locality is 824233.

Gaya is nearest town to sadipur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.
